MJ21194G belongs to the category of power transistors.
It is commonly used in high-power audio amplifiers, power supplies, and industrial applications.
The MJ21194G comes in a TO-204AA package.
This product is essential for high-power electronic applications requiring efficient and reliable power transistors.
The MJ21194G is typically packaged individually and is available in various quantities depending on the supplier.
The MJ21194G has a standard pin configuration with three pins: collector, base, and emitter.
The MJ21194G operates based on the principles of bipolar junction transistors, utilizing the control of current flow between its collector and emitter terminals through the base terminal.
The MJ21194G is widely used in: - High-power audio amplifiers - Power supplies - Industrial motor control systems - High-voltage regulators
Some alternative models to MJ21194G include: - MJ15003G - MJL4281A - 2N3055
